Indications for User
•
Use fruit cut in pieces or grated to purée, instead of whole fruit, to prepare fruit
beverages.
•
The mixing beaker must always be filled to the minimum level, so that liquid
reaches the mixing rod.
•
In the case of preparing very thin beverages, pay particular attention not to
exceed the maximum volume of the mixing beaker, thus preventing overflowing
of contents during the mixing process.
•
The best results are obtained then ingredients are as cold as possible. Milk
cocktails taste the best when they are prepared with a very cold milk. The colder
the milk, the more dense and frothed the beverage will be.
•
Syrups and powders should always be added immediately prior to mixing, so
that they do not fall to the bottom of the mixing beaker.
•
Always fill the mixing beaker with liquid ingredients first, and then with solid
ones.
•
The bar mixer is not suitable for crushing ice. Should a beverage require ice,
add an already crushed ice.
